Transaction 5ffbe41eb10bd20180c8f93c8a68deec08c28a6a2118112e1b645812784fb369

1 Input
2 Outputs
  • 5ffbe41eb10bd20180c8f93c8a68deec08c28a6a2118112e1b645812784fb369:0
  • value  10959397
    address  1Pd2BPWDGi6mqFSa475eV9byLiJjJKGeWe
  • 5ffbe41eb10bd20180c8f93c8a68deec08c28a6a2118112e1b645812784fb369:1
  • value  15000000
    address  1Mo5btPL1USv2gZhi91aCx8ZU4y1ncPPkm